Qualifications

To become​ a medical office assistant in Toronto, you typically need ⁣to complete a diploma program in medical office administration. These programs are offered‍ by community colleges and career colleges throughout the city. Some employers may​ also require certification‌ from the Canadian Medical Association (CMA).

Key qualifications for a medical office assistant include:

  • Strong communication skills
  • Excellent organizational skills
  • Knowledge of medical terminology
  • Proficiency in office software such as Microsoft Office

Duties

Medical office assistants in Toronto perform a​ variety of administrative tasks to support healthcare professionals. Some common duties include:

  • Greeting patients and‌ checking them in
  • Scheduling appointments
  • Managing⁣ medical records
  • Processing insurance claims
  • Assisting with billing and coding

Medical‌ office assistants also play a crucial role in ensuring that patients have a positive experience at the medical office. They may answer phone calls, respond to ⁣patient inquiries, and provide information ​about services offered.

Career Outlook

The demand for medical ‍office assistants ‍in ‌Toronto is expected to remain strong in the coming years. As the⁢ population ages and healthcare services continue to expand, there will be a growing need for skilled medical office assistants to support healthcare professionals.

According to the Government of Canada Job Bank, the average annual salary for medical⁣ office⁣ assistants⁢ in Toronto is around $40,000. With ⁣experience and additional training, ⁤medical office⁣ assistants can ⁢advance to ​supervisory roles or specialize in areas such ‍as medical billing‍ and coding.
